Printing is faint

Printing is faint
Cause
You may be printing on the wrong side
of the paper.
The Printhead nozzles are clogged.
Because the printer was left without ink
tanks installed for some time, ink has
become clogged in the ink supply sys-
tem.
Paper is jammed inside the Top Cover.
The ink was not dry when paper was
cut.
Printing may be faint if Print Quality in
Advanced Settings in the printer driver
is set to Standard or Draft.
You are printing on paper that tends to
generate dust when cut.

Print on the printing surface.
Print a test pattern to check the nozzles and see if they are clogged.
(See "Checking for Nozzle Clogging.")
After the ink tanks have been installed for 24 hours, run Head Cleaning B from the Control
Panel.
(See "Cleaning the Printhead.")
Follow the steps below to remove the jammed piece of paper inside the Top Cover.
1.
Open the Top Cover and make sure the Carriage is not over the Platen.
2.
Remove any scraps of paper inside the Top Cover.
(See "Clearing Jammed Roll Paper.")
(See "Clearing a Jammed Sheet, Fed Manually.")
3.
Close the Top Cover.
Specify a longer drying period in the Control Panel menu, in Paper Details > Roll DryingTime.
(See "Menu Settings.")
→User's Guide
In Advanced Settings of the printer driver, choose Highest or High in Print Quality.
Printing in Draft or Standard mode is faster and consumes less ink than in Highest or High
modes, but the printing quality is lower.
(See "Giving Priority to Particular Graphic Elements and Colors for Printing.")
In the Control Panel menu, set CutDustReduct. in Paper Details to On.
(See "Reducing Dust from Cutting Rolls.")
Load paper of the same type as you have specified in the printer driver.
